How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cleveland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cleveland Heights Studio Apartments | $1,430 | $624 | $3,215 |
| Cleveland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,474 | $500 | $5,394 |
| Cleveland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,705 | $650 | $6,270 |
| Cleveland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,006 | $900 | $7,815 |
| Cleveland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,005 | $838 | $8,451 |
| Cleveland Heights 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,594 | $950 | $7,326 |

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cleveland Heights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cleveland Heights ranges from $500 to $5,394 with an average monthly rent of $1,474.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cleveland Heights c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cleveland Heights range from $650 to $6,270.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,705.
How expensive are Cleveland Heights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 173 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cleveland Heights on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$900 to $7,815 - averaging $2,006 for the location.
